In this episode of the Medical English Podcast, we focus on the small but powerful phrases that make a huge difference in patient communication. Perfect for healthcare professionals who learned English as a second language, we break down three commonly used expressions that will help you build rapport, sound natural, and manage patient expectations with ease:
• Book in – Friendly and efficient language for scheduling appointments
• Pop in – Approachable phrasing for short or informal visits
• See how you go – Collaborative, reassuring language for monitoring progress or treatment plans
We cover pronunciation, tone, regional differences, and practical examples you can use every day in your clinic, whether you’re in the UK, Australia, or Ireland.
You’ll also learn the common mistakes to avoid, so your communication is professional, clear, and patient-friendly.
